Event Details
Nicknamed the “Emperor”, Beethoven’s last piano concerto is bursting with bold themes and fiery cadenzas, as well as one of his most emotive slow movements.
The UVA University Singers, conducted by Michael Slon, join the orchestra for the second half of the program. Works include Equus by Eric Whitacre, (equus is Latin for “horse”); Jennifer Higdon’s O magnum mysterium, a clever setting of the traditional text in both Latin and English; and a cantata for tenor and chamber orchestra based on psalm texts, I Will Lift Up Mine Eyes by Adolphus Hailstork.
Saturday, November 11 at 7:30pm
Old Cabell Hall, University of Virginia
Sunday, November 12 at 3:30pm
Martin Luther King, Jr. Performing Arts Center
